a^2-24a=-44
We move all terms to the left:
a^2-24a-(-44)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
a^2-24a+44=0
a = 1; b = -24; c = +44;
Δ = b2-4ac
Δ = -242-4·1·44
Δ = 400
The delta value is higher than zero, so the equation has two solutions
We use following formulas to calculate our solutions:$a_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$$a_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$$\sqrt{\Delta}=\sqrt{400}=20$$a_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-24)-20}{2*1}=\frac{4}{2} =2 $$a_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-24)+20}{2*1}=\frac{44}{2} =22 $
